GR Baker Memorial Hospital

is a full care hospital with 27 Acute Care beds, 4 ICU beds and 5 crisis stabilization beds.

Some services provided the hospital:

Full Emergency Medical Care Laboratory Diagnostic Imaging Pharmacy General Surgery Internal Medicine Otolaryngology (ENT) Community Cancer Care Physiotherapy Respiratory Therapy Environmental Health Speech and Language Therapy Visiting specialists in Cardiology, Pediatrics, Orthopedics, Plastic Surgery, Urology and Ophthalmology Video conferencing for consultations with specialists or physicians in other areas. Quesnel

Quesnel is a small city with big opportunity. It boasts a vibrant, creative and family friendly lifestyle, rich with culture and community spirit. The city is nestled on the banks of the Quesnel and Fraser rivers, and has a diverse population of 23,000 people. The major industries include forestry, agriculture, mining and tourism. Quesnel offers affordable housing, twelve public schools, one Christian school, and two post-secondary schools. Who we are



Northern Health covers an area of nearly 600,000 square kilometers and offers health services in over two dozen communities and 55 First Nation's communities. We deliver hospital and community-based health care for a population of 300,000.

Employing more than 7,000 staff throughout the region, Northern Health provides exceptional health services for Northerners, through the efforts of dedicated staff and physicians, in partnership with communities and organizations in Northern BC.

There is a wide variety of career opportunities available in our two dozen hospitals, 25 long-term care facilities, public health units and many other offices providing specialized services.
